On March 1, the Vietnam Aquatic Products Processing and Exporting Association (VASEP) revealed that in the first two months of 2021, the export of aquatic products exceeded US$1 billion, a year-on-year increase of 2.
2%.
Among them, exports in January and February reached 606 million U.
S.
dollars and 405 million U.
S.
dollars, respectively.
VASEP stated that in the first two months of this year, the main export products were frozen vannamei prawns, fish balls, dried anchovies, dried squid, fish fillets, etc.

With the exception of China and the European Union, Vietnam’s fish survey exports to most markets have shown a recovery trend.
Specifically, in January, the value of fish survey exports to the US market increased by 51% year-on-year; the value of exports to CPTPP member countries increased by 38% year-on-year.
With the growth trend in the first two months of this year and the advantages brought by various free trade agreements, Vietnam’s exports of aquatic products in March are expected to reach US$640 million, an increase of 1.
5% compared to the same period in 2020.
(Finish)
